Connected data

When connected, Windmill securely reads the following information from Attio:
Windmill stores Attio note and thread-comment text. The integration does not sync email message bodies.

Permissions

Windmill requests read-only access to relevant Attio objects.
Windmill only collects context necessary for performance and coaching — not full CRM data exports.
Synced Attio data is visible to Windmill members who are also users of the connected Attio system. Windmill does not copy record-level Attio permissions.
